The Development Associate is primarily responsible for gift entry and reporting, Development database integrity and accuracy, and supporting special events. The Development Associate reports to the Director of Development, and supports all areas of Development, including Annual Giving, Capital Campaigns, Alumni Relations & Special Events. This is a full-time, benefits eligible, hourly- salaried position (non-exempt). Responsibilities:

Salary range: $45,000 - $57,000 + benefits Start Date: Immediate About Kent Denver School: Kent Denver School is a college preparatory day school of 750+ students in grades 6-12 located on 200 acres in suburban Denver. Kent Denver has been recognized for our leadership in diversity, equity, and inclusion. We are committed to fostering a culturally diverse faculty and student body and we are eager to consider applications from candidates who believe in the critical importance of diversity in the life of a school.
